
The average NextGen Healthcare QA Manager earns an estimated $121,563 annually. NextGen Healthcare's QA Manager compensation is $3,685 more than the US average for a QA Manager.
The Engineering Department at NextGen Healthcare earns $254 more on average than the Legal Department.

QA Managers earn $5,688 more than Senior Developers, and $2,642 less than Sales Engineers.
The Engineering Department averages $254 more than the Legal Department, and $15,928 less than the Product Department
The average female QA Manager at companies similar size to NextGen Healthcare reported making $87,758, while the average male QA Manager at similar sized companies reported making $125,120.
The average Asian or Pacific Islander QA Manager at companies similar size to NextGen Healthcare reported making $129,847, while the average African American/Black QA Manager at similar sized companies reported making $97,500.
The majority of QA Managers at NextGen Healthcare believe they're compensated fairly. 50% of QA Managers at NextGen Healthcare say they receive annual bonuses, and the majority (61%) are satisfied with their benefits. See more compensation ratings at NextGen Healthcare
